February 8, 1901 - May 5, 1917

AUTOIST HIT BY TRAIN
Eagle Grove Boy Dies as Result of Accident

Eagle Grove was the scene of another terrible auto accident. Saturday, Ed Keena, a young man of about 16, was struck by a Great Western passenger train at 1 p. m., on South Commercial avenue, within the city limits. He was alone in a Ford racer which was demolished, the driver having one arm broken in two places, one leg cut off and suffering internal injuries. He was taken to the hospital where he died about 7 p. m., the same day.

Renwick Times - Renwick, Iowa
May 10, 1917
